ANNOUNCEMENT AND INVITATION Pirates, Thieves and Innocents: Perceptions of Copyright Infringement in the Digital Age http://www.umuc.edu/cip/symposium June 16-17, 2005 HOSTED by the Center for Intellectual Property and being held at the UMUC Inn and Conference Center in Adelphi, MD THEME: The 2005 CIP Symposium will explore the ways in which we think and talk about copyright infringement in our digital age and will focus on issues relevant to the higher education community and the delivery of third-party copyrighted content. Speakers will include representatives from the academy, library, law, corporation, nonprofit organization, technology sector, and Capitol Hill. TOPICS to be addressed by speakers and panelists will include: --The Impact of Copyright Law and Policy on Academic Culture --P2P File Sharing: Pirates or Revolutionaries? --Culture and Copyright: A Creative Clash? --Regulatory Copyright: How Will Universities be Affected? --Copyright Infringement in the Digital Age: What Universities Need to Know --Responses to Copyright Infringement at University Campuses: Best Practices --The Copyright Legislative Landscape REGISTER now since space is limited.
